Chapter 16 - Chapter 16: “Don’t Try to Guess a Woman’s Thoughts”

The afternoon schedule wasn't heavy.

By the time the last class ended, it was only a little past three. Getting back to Baker Street would be easy.

"Mr. Watson, do you have any other plans this afternoon?"

Mary set down her fountain pen and looked at Russell, who had already packed up and was clearly preparing to bolt.

"No specific plans," Russell said. "But I need to tell Holmes about the case first. This is mainly for the sake of my sleep quality tonight."

"All right." Mary nodded. "Then… see you tomorrow."

"See you tomorrow."

After parting ways with Mary, Russell left the classroom at a brisk pace, exited the campus, boarded a tram, and headed toward Baker Street.

Back inside the classroom, Mary watched Russell's figure disappear—and only then did the faint smile at the corner of her mouth slowly fade.

She tidied her things at an unhurried pace, occasionally lifting her head to respond—polite, measured, basic courtesy—to the classmates who drifted closer, attempting to curry favor.

For Mary Morstan, socializing and reading people were skills she'd mastered long ago.

What attitude to show, what tone to use, what kind of reply would yield the result—or the answer—she wanted.

To her, these were fill-in-the-blank questions. Do enough of them, you develop a feel for the pattern, and you start applying formulas without thinking.

Unbidden, her mind returned to last night—to the ill-mannered thief's "compliment."

—A social butterfly who plays all sides.

Much as she hated to admit it, she couldn't deny that the label was accurate.

She simply despised having it pointed out to her face.

"Tch."

Just remembering that infuriating, punchable attitude made Mary click her tongue.

Next time she saw him, she'd break his leg.

[Mary Morstan is displeased by your provocations last night. Malice +10]

"?"

On the tram, Russell looked up and reflexively glanced around, bewildered.

What now?

What did I even do this time?

Why is she digging up old accounts now?

Don't try to guess a woman's thoughts—guessing won't help you understand them anyway.

Russell sighed, then got off at his stop.

The moment he pushed open the door to 221B Baker Street, he saw Mrs. Hudson busy in the kitchen.

"Russell, you're back so early?"

"Yeah. Not many classes this afternoon." Russell nodded. "Where's Holmes?"

"Charlotte? She's been in her room all day, hasn't come out once—except for lunch," Mrs. Hudson said. "Seems like she's working a big case, but she can't find a way in."

"If she can't find a way in, that's because she's looking at the wrong door," Russell chuckled as he went upstairs. "Her direction's been wrong from the start."

He paused at Charlotte's door and was about to open it when it swung open first.

Charlotte Holmes stood in the doorway, still wearing the oversized robe from last night.

Clearly, the Nicholas Winter case had irritated her to the point where she couldn't even be bothered to change clothes.

"Who did you say had the wrong direction?"

Before Russell could speak, Charlotte struck first.

"Obviously you," Russell replied calmly. "From the beginning, your line of reasoning has been wrong."

Charlotte's gray-blue eyes narrowed—like an offended cat that had just been challenged.

She didn't refute him immediately. Instead, she stepped aside and signaled him in with a look.

The room was even messier than last night.

Nicholas Winter's file, the scene photos, Edgar Light's background—all scattered across the floor. And the skull atop the fireplace looked as though it were mocking every effort made within these walls.

"A person who just finished university classes," Charlotte said, "now intends to inform me that my deductions are wrong."

"Begin your performance, Mr. Watson. I'm listening."

Her voice was emotionless. Arms folded, she leaned against the wall and watched him.

"I wouldn't call it a performance," Russell said, stepping around the hazards on the floor to find a clean patch to stand. "But would you believe me if I said I had a dream last night?"

"A dream?" Charlotte raised an eyebrow; impatience nearly overflowed her expression.

"If you're about to say an angel told you the truth, I'm throwing you out."

[Charlotte Holmes is strongly irritated by your theatrics. Malice +20]

See? She's already irritated.

"Relax," Russell shrugged. "I'm just saying—at university, I happened to hear some gossip. And that gossip happens to prove one thing."

"You got the motive wrong from the start."

"Motive?" Charlotte gave a quiet scoff. "A fortune large enough to change a man's fate—doesn't that suffice?"

"What if," Russell countered, "that fortune was always going to be his anyway?"

The mocking expression on Charlotte's face froze for a fraction of a second.

"Go on," she said.

"Someone told me Nicholas Winter had already intended to leave everything to his apprentice—from the beginning," Russell said. "And he'd said it in public. Edgar Light was there when he said it."

Charlotte fell silent.

"That proves nothing," she said. "What if he couldn't wait?"

"That's where the second piece of gossip comes in." Russell smiled—maddeningly calm.

"Nicholas Winter wasn't going to live long."

"...!"

Charlotte's pupils constricted sharply.

"Unknown illness. Initially misdiagnosed as consumption, but it clearly wasn't," Russell explained evenly. "Some disease that current medicine can't diagnose."

"And not many people knew about it."

"A teacher with little time left. An apprentice with inheritance all but guaranteed."

"Tell me, Miss Holmes—does your 'murder for money' theory still stand?"

Charlotte stared at him.

The room turned brutally quiet, with only the distant noise of Baker Street seeping in through the windows.

"Your source," she said at last, voice roughened.

"Mary Morstan," Russell replied without hesitation, selling Mary out cleanly.

She won't confront her anyway.

And even if she does—Mary's far too skilled for Charlotte to gain much.

And even if—worst case—she does…

Russell liked watching women fight.

At the name, something like recognition flickered across Charlotte's eyes.

"So it was her," she murmured, then fell into thought again.

The old chain of logic collapsed; a new chain assembled in her mind at speed.

Less than two minutes later, Charlotte looked up, then strode to the telephone.

Dial. Receiver. No wasted motion.

"Lestrade."

No pleasantries. Straight to the blade.

"Let him go. Nicholas Winter killed himself."
